Municipal Detroit left paperwork behind. Meeting minutes, ordinances, reports, budgets, personnel records, court documents, directories, maps, and newspapers can be combined to reconstruct how institutions actually functioned.

Minutes, ordinances, budgets, reports, personnel files and court records turn broad claims about municipal power into things that can be checked. One document rarely tells the whole story, but several records can establish who acted, when and under what authority.
Minutes, ordinances, budgets, personnel files, directories, maps, and court records are identified by source before they are combined.
